- Title
Development and Testing of a Tool to Create Multiple Conical Reamed Cable Bolt Anchorages in Weak Rock.
- Authors
Jia, Housheng; Wang, Yinwei; Liu, Shaowei; Fu, Mengxiong
- Abstract
The MCRT and its corresponding anchoring method are easy to use, reliable, and can be used to install cable bolts with a resin-surrounding rock bond strong enough to match the supporting force of the high-strength cable in the cable bolt. The breaking force of conventionally anchored cable bolt with a diameter of 17.8 mm was 355 kN. After the resin had hardened, the cable bolts were pre-tightened so that the changes in cable bolt support forces could be monitored as the working face advanced toward test site.
